Week 3 Introduction

video-placeholder
Loading...
查看授課大綱

您將學習的技能

Laziness, Type Class, Functional Programming, Referential Transparency, Reactive Programming

審閱

4.5(3,117 個評分)

  • 5 stars
    66.21%
  • 4 stars
    24.09%
  • 3 stars
    7.60%
  • 2 stars
    1.63%
  • 1 star
    0.44%

AD

2021年7月2日

Wonderful course by Martin Odersky himself. The content is awesome and the way Martin has explained the concepts in Scala 3 syntax and features is great. A course for every Scala developer.

HH

2016年7月23日

Really enjoyed doing the course. Learned a ton of Stuff. Functional programming design is amazing. It's like learning Object Oriented programming (with design patterns) for the first time.

從本節課中

Type-Directed Programming

This week, we’ll learn how to make the compiler write programs for us! We’ll see how the compiler can summon program fragments based on their type and how this mechanism can be used to implement a new form of polymorphism (type classes).

教學方

  • Placeholder

    Martin Odersky

    Professor

探索我們的目錄

免費加入並獲得個性化推薦、更新和優惠。